When it comes to the Spring Festival, one cannot ignore the importance of the dining table and the etiquette that surrounds it. In Chinese culture, the dining table during the Spring Festival represents more than just a place to eat; it symbolizes unity, respect, and love within the family.

During the Spring Festival, families gather around the table to enjoy a variety of traditional dishes. One of the key features of the Chinese New Year feast is the abundance of food. This represents prosperity and good luck for the upcoming year. There is a saying in Chinese culture, \"The more you eat during the Spring Festival, the more prosperous you will be in the following year.\"

Another important aspect of the dining table during the Spring Festival is the use of chopsticks. Chinese people believe that using chopsticks brings good luck and fortune. It is considered impolite to point your chopsticks directly at another person, as it is reminiscent of a grave ceremony. It is also customary to hold your chopsticks properly and not to cross them on the table, as this is seen as a bad omen.

Furthermore, the Spring Festival is a time to enjoy various traditional dishes that have specific meanings. For example, fish is a staple on the Spring Festival dining table because the Chinese word for \"fish\" sounds similar to the word for \"surplus.\" Eating fish symbolizes an abundance of wealth and prosperity for the upcoming year. Another popular dish is dumplings, which are shaped like ancient Chinese silver ingots and represent wealth and good fortune.

In conclusion, the dining table during the Spring Festival carries great significance in Chinese culture. It represents unity, prosperity, and good luck. The traditional dishes and the dining etiquette add to the festive atmosphere and create a sense of warmth and love within the family.

New Year\'s celebrations in China are a grand event that lasts for one month. The Chinese New Year, also known as the Spring Festival, is rich in traditions and customs. In 2012, the Spring Festival fell on January 23rd according to the lunar calendar.

During the Spring Festival, families gather together to celebrate and welcome the new year. One of the most important traditions is the reunion dinner, where family members from far and wide come together to enjoy a sumptuous feast. This meal symbolizes unity and good fortune for the upcoming year.

When it comes to traditional food during the Spring Festival, there are numerous delicacies that hold special meanings. For example, fish is a staple dish as it represents abundance and prosperity. It is customary to leave some fish on the plate after the meal to symbolize surplus for the year ahead.

Another popular dish is jiaozi, or dumplings, which are eaten on New Year\'s Eve. These dumplings have a crescent shape, symbolizing wealth and good luck. It is believed that the more dumplings you eat during the Spring Festival, the more money you will make in the coming year.

The Spring Festival is a time for joy, celebration, and reflection. It is a time to honor ancestors, pay respects to elders, and exchange well-wishes and gifts. The festive atmosphere, vibrant decorations, and delectable food make the Spring Festival a truly special and memorable occasion in China.

过年各地有什么特色美食?

Let\'s talk about some of the unique and delightful delicacies that different regions of China have to offer during the Spring Festival! Every region in China has its own distinct culinary traditions and specialties that make the festive season even more exciting.

In my hometown, for example, we have a specialty called jiaozi, which are dumplings with various fillings. They are carefully shaped, steamed, or pan-fried to perfection. Jiaozi symbolize wealth and good luck, and they are a staple dish in our region during the Spring Festival.

In the southern part of China, people often enjoy tangyuan, sweet glutinous rice balls filled with delicious fillings like sesame, peanut, or red bean paste. These round and sticky rice balls symbolize family unity and happiness.

In the coastal regions, seafood plays a significant role in the festive cuisine. People indulge in fresh and succulent dishes such as steamed fish, braised abalone, or stir-fried prawns. These dishes not only represent abundance and prosperity but also highlight the coastal culture and culinary traditions.

Additionally, in the northern part of China, special meat dishes like roasted whole lamb, cumin-spiced skewers, and stuffed buns are popular during the Spring Festival. These dishes showcase the rich flavors and hearty cuisine of the region.
